Linux Kernel  3.7.1
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Functions | Variables
common.c File Reference
#include <linux/kernel.h>
#include <linux/delay.h>
#include <linux/init.h>
#include <linux/platform_device.h>
#include <linux/pci.h>
#include <linux/clk-provider.h>
#include <linux/ata_platform.h>
#include <linux/gpio.h>
#include <linux/of.h>
#include <linux/of_platform.h>
#include <asm/page.h>
#include <asm/setup.h>
#include <asm/timex.h>
#include <asm/hardware/cache-tauros2.h>
#include <asm/mach/map.h>
#include <asm/mach/time.h>
#include <asm/mach/pci.h>
#include <mach/dove.h>
#include <mach/pm.h>
#include <mach/bridge-regs.h>
#include <asm/mach/arch.h>
#include <linux/irq.h>
#include <plat/time.h>
#include <linux/platform_data/usb-ehci-orion.h>
#include <plat/irq.h>
#include <plat/common.h>
#include <plat/addr-map.h>
#include "common.h"

Go to the source code of this file.

Functions

void __init dove_map_io (void)
 
void __init dove_ehci0_init (void)
 
void __init dove_ehci1_init (void)
 
void __init dove_ge00_init (struct mv643xx_eth_platform_data *eth_data)
 
void __init dove_rtc_init (void)
 
void __init dove_sata_init (struct mv_sata_platform_data *sata_data)
 
void __init dove_uart0_init (void)
 
void __init dove_uart1_init (void)
 
void __init dove_uart2_init (void)
 
void __init dove_uart3_init (void)
 
void __init dove_spi0_init (void)
 
void __init dove_spi1_init (void)
 
void __init dove_i2c_init (void)
 
void __init dove_init_early (void)
 
void __init dove_crypto_init (void)
 
void __init dove_xor0_init (void)
 
void __init dove_xor1_init (void)
 
void __init dove_sdio0_init (void)
 
void __init dove_sdio1_init (void)
 
void __init dove_init (void)
 
void dove_restart (char mode, const char *cmd)
 

Variables

struct sys_timer dove_timer
 

Function Documentation

void __init dove_crypto_init ( void  )

Definition at line 257 of file common.c.

void __init dove_ehci0_init ( void  )

Definition at line 133 of file common.c.

void __init dove_ehci1_init ( void  )

Definition at line 141 of file common.c.

void __init dove_ge00_init ( struct mv643xx_eth_platform_data eth_data)

Definition at line 149 of file common.c.

void __init dove_i2c_init ( void  )

Definition at line 225 of file common.c.

void __init dove_init ( void  )

Definition at line 342 of file common.c.

void __init dove_init_early ( void  )

Definition at line 233 of file common.c.

void __init dove_map_io ( void  )

Definition at line 57 of file common.c.

void dove_restart ( char  mode,
const char cmd 
)

Definition at line 361 of file common.c.

void __init dove_rtc_init ( void  )

Definition at line 159 of file common.c.

void __init dove_sata_init ( struct mv_sata_platform_data sata_data)

Definition at line 167 of file common.c.

void __init dove_sdio0_init ( void  )

Definition at line 309 of file common.c.

void __init dove_sdio1_init ( void  )

Definition at line 337 of file common.c.

void __init dove_spi0_init ( void  )

Definition at line 212 of file common.c.

void __init dove_spi1_init ( void  )

Definition at line 217 of file common.c.

void __init dove_uart0_init ( void  )

Definition at line 176 of file common.c.

void __init dove_uart1_init ( void  )

Definition at line 185 of file common.c.

void __init dove_uart2_init ( void  )

Definition at line 194 of file common.c.

void __init dove_uart3_init ( void  )

Definition at line 203 of file common.c.

void __init dove_xor0_init ( void  )

Definition at line 266 of file common.c.

void __init dove_xor1_init ( void  )

Definition at line 275 of file common.c.

Variable Documentation

struct sys_timer dove_timer
Initial value:
= {
.init = dove_timer_init,
}

Definition at line 250 of file common.c.